When choosing a booking engine for your hotel, you’re looking for a platform that drives direct bookings, offers reliable support, and integrates well into your existing operations. Blastness AI Booking Engine and wikhotel both aim to serve these needs but differ significantly in their focus, user feedback, and scope. Blastness is a dedicated, feature-rich booking platform with a proven track record and recent reviews, while wikhotel appears more as an all-in-one property management system with limited public feedback on its booking capabilities. Which one aligns better with your hotel's growth goals?
Blastness is a specialized booking engine boasting a high recent review count (118 reviews, 25 in the last six months) and a strong user satisfaction rating. Its focus is on conversion optimization, dynamic pricing, and seamless integration with PMS and RMS, making it ideal for hotels prioritizing direct channel growth. Wikhotel, by contrast, lacks recent reviews and visible user feedback, making its effectiveness less clear.
Blastness’s recent reviews highlight a 4.89/5 ease of use, customer support, and a 9.81/10 NPS score, indicating high customer loyalty. Wikhotel, with no recent reviews or scores, offers an unknown user experience and limited evidence of its booking engine’s performance. Are you willing to rely on a platform with proven recent user satisfaction, or are you exploring a broader property management solution with uncertain booking capabilities?
If your hotel needs a dedicated, high-performing booking engine that significantly boosts direct bookings and revenue, Blastness is the clear choice. Its extensive feature set (38 unique features), integration with over 15 verified partners, and strong regional presence make it ideal for hotels aiming to optimize their online distribution and revenue management.
If your focus is on a comprehensive property management system that might also include booking capabilities, wikhotel could be considered, but its lack of recent reviews and detailed feature info make it a less assured choice. For hotels seeking a proven, conversion-focused booking platform, Blastness is the stronger candidate.
Blastness scores a 4.89/5 in ease of use, with many reviews praising its intuitive interface, smooth onboarding, and reliable performance. Users report that the platform simplifies daily operations, with a notable emphasis on smooth navigation and quick setup, supported by onboarding ratings of 4.82/5.
Wikhotel's ease of use remains unquantified, as there are no recent reviews or user ratings available. Without documented user feedback, it's unclear whether their platform offers the same straightforward experience. Based on available data, your team is more likely to find Blastness easier to adopt.
Edge: Blastness.
Blastness offers an extensive suite of 38 features exclusive to its platform, including mobile optimization, special offers, urgency messaging, booking abandonment recapture, multi-room bookings, rate comparison widgets, multi-lingual support, and integrations with Google Hotel Ads, TripAdvisor, and secure payment solutions like Stripe and PayPal.
Wikhotel, with no publicly listed or verified features, lacks this level of dedicated booking tools or marketing integrations. For a feature-rich booking engine designed to maximize conversions and revenue, Blastness clearly leads.
Edge: Blastness.
Blastness’s support scores a 4.89/5, with recent reviews describing the support team as responsive, knowledgeable, and helpful. Users appreciate the proactive onboarding and the ongoing assistance, though some mention a desire for 24/7 availability to handle urgent issues more rapidly.
Wikhotel provides no recent review data or verified support scores, leaving its support quality uncertain. Without explicit user feedback, Blastness's established reputation for quality support makes it the safer choice.
Edge: Blastness.
Blastness boasts 15 verified partners, including Upsellguru, Oracle Hospitality, and hotelcube, enabling seamless connection with PMS, RMS, and other distribution channels. These integrations help streamline operations and expand distribution opportunities.
In contrast, wikhotel has zero verified integrations listed, suggesting limited or no open integration ecosystem. For hotels seeking a platform that easily connects with industry-standard tools, Blastness has a clear advantage.
Edge: Blastness.
Blastness’s recent reviews (25 in the last six months) consistently rate it highly, with an overall score of 87.88/100 and a likelihood to recommend of 98%. Users from various segments, especially city center and resort hotels, praise its ease of use, support, and impact on revenue.
Wikhotel lacks recent reviews or ratings, making it impossible to gauge user satisfaction. Based on current data, Blastness is the higher-rated, more trusted platform among hoteliers.
Edge: Blastness.
Both platforms do not publicly disclose specific pricing details, likely due to customized quotes based on hotel size and needs. However, Blastness’s transparent model indicates no implementation or subscription fees, focusing on value through its feature set.
Since wikhotel’s pricing remains undisclosed and no trial information is available, budget-conscious hotels should lean toward Blastness’s proven value and clear ROI potential.

The HT Score is a composite ranking that considers 4 criteria groups and over a dozen variables to help hoteliers objectively compare hotel technology products. Blastness has an HT Score of 88 and wikhotel has 0. Here is how the score is calculated.
| Criteria Group | Weight | What It Measures |
|---|---|---|
| Customer Ratings & Reviews |
|
How highly do users recommend this product? Ratings Score, Review Volume, Share of Voice, Review Depth, Review Recency, Success Stories ▾ The most heavily weighted factor. Analyzes average satisfaction ratings (likelihood to recommend, ease of use, support, ROI), total review count relative to category peers, review recency (at least 20 reviews in the trailing 6 months), and share of voice across unique hotel clients to detect selection bias. |
| Partner Ecosystem |
|
How highly do tech partners recommend this company? Partner Recommendations, Integration Quantity, Integration Quality ▾ Evaluates partner recommendations as expert votes of confidence, the number of verified integrations, and ecosystem quality — the average HT Scores of integration partners. Products with higher-quality integration ecosystems are more likely to deliver a connected tech stack. |
| Customer Centricity |
|
How customer-centric is this organization? Certified Support, Review Consistency, Profile Completeness ▾ Assesses whether the company has earned HTR Customer Support Certification, maintains consistent review collection over time (an indicator of feedback-driven culture), and keeps product profiles complete with capabilities, screenshots, pricing, and features. |
| Reach, Staying Power & Resources |
|
How extensive is this company's reach and resourcing? Geographic Reach, Staying Power, Company Resources, Trending Score ▾ Measures global presence (countries and regions served), years in business as a stability proxy, team headcount as a resource proxy, and a trending score based on trailing-twelve-month buyer inquiries, reviews, partner recommendations, and press activity. |
Customer ratings and reviews are by far the most important factor in the HT Score algorithm. HTR does not accept payment for higher rankings. All reviews are verified — only hotel industry practitioners with confirmed affiliations can submit ratings. View full HT Score methodology →
